Output 51c91cd27839dcebcf8d92e0d5ffef96c83d75d9da864ef8b25b5bccb33de45f:1

value
945167496
script pubkey
OP_0 OP_PUSHBYTES_20 085ebdb4f008d842c45ecefea51e25033e875b36
address
bc1qpp0tmd8sprvy93z7eml22839qvlgwkekhm5ge7
transaction
51c91cd27839dcebcf8d92e0d5ffef96c83d75d9da864ef8b25b5bccb33de45f
spent
true